The street in brief

Mandeville Close is mostly det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£352,250 — roughly 14% above the RG30 norm.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£4,160, above the district's £3,896.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across RG30 prices have held broadly level over the last few years. With 36 sales across 25 homes since 2001, homes here come to market only rarely.

Mandeville Close's £352,250 median sits about 14% above RG30's £310,000; on floor space it runs £4,160/m² against the district's £3,896/m² (+7%).

Street and RG30 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
